SECTION 2. AUTHORIZATION TO USE STORM WATER (CONDITIONS). The
City hereby consents to M/1's use of storm water within White Cedar for irrigation purposes
subject to the following conditions:
(a). M/I shall install the Reclaimed Water Backup System, which shall (i)
connect to the City's reclaimed water system, (ii) be a fully functional reclaimed water
distribution system of sufficient capacity to service the entire White Cedar development,
(iii) include purple reclaimed water meter boxes at each residential unit and/or service
location, and (iv) include a lockable curb stop allowing for future installation of individual
meters.
(b). M/I shall install a master reclaim water meter (the "Master Reclaim Water
Meter") located at the point of connection between the Reclaimed Water Backup System
and the City's Reclaimed Water system and be connected per DEP requirements, back
flow device or air gap. The system will measure the available storm water and in the event
there is insufficient storm water available to the Storm Water Irrigation System, reclaimed
water shall be accessed by means of he Reclaimed Water Backup System and usage
shall be measured by the Master Reclaim Water Meter.
(c). The White Cedar Community Association, Inc. (the "HOA") shall pay a
reclaimed water rate of $15 per month per residential unit (48 Units @ $15/month =
$720/month) based upon expected usage of 270 gallons per day per residential unit
(12,960 gallons per day X 3 days per week X 4 weeks per month = 155,520
gallons/month). In the event of usage in excess of 155,520 gallons per month, the excess
shall be charged at then current reclaimed water rates promulgated by the City.
(d). If the HOA elects to permanently convert to the Reclaim Water System
within White Cedar, then (i) an individual reclaimed water meter shall be installed at each
single-family residential unit within White Cedar by the owner of such residential unit and
(ii) the Master Reclaim Water Meter shall be eliminated at the HOA's cost. All Residential
Units and Park/Common Areas shall have individual meters and all to be converted
together at the same time.
(e). Irrigation of White Cedar shall otherwise comply with the City Code,
